003 WHUS73 KLOT 182051 MWWLOT URGENT - MARINE WEATHER MESSAGE National Weather Service Chicago IL 251 PM CST Sun Jan 18 2026 LMZ744-745-190500- /O.EXT.KLOT.UP.W.0001.260119T0600Z-260120T0300Z/ /O.CON.KLOT.GL.W.0004.260119T0600Z-260119T2100Z/ Gary to Burns Harbor IN-Burns Harbor to Michigan City IN- 251 PM CST Sun Jan 18 2026 ...HEAVY FREEZING SPRAY WARNING NOW IN EFFECT FROM MIDNIGHT TONIGHT TO 9 PM CST MONDAY... ...GALE WARNING REMAINS IN EFFECT FROM MIDNIGHT TONIGHT TO 3 PM CST MONDAY... * WHAT...For the Gale Warning, northwest gales to 40 kt and significant waves to 12 ft occasionally to 16 ft expected. For the Heavy Freezing Spray Warning, heavy freezing spray at a rate of 2 cm per hour or greater expected, and may rapidly accumulate on vessels. * WHERE...Gary to Michigan City IN. * WHEN...For the Heavy Freezing Spray Warning, from midnight tonight to 9 PM CST Monday. For the Gale Warning, from midnight tonight to 3 PM CST Monday. * IMPACTS...Operating a vessel in heavy freezing spray is hazardous. Freezing spray may render mechanical and electronic components inoperative. Rapid ice accretion on decks and superstructures may result in a catastrophic loss of stability. Strong winds will cause hazardous waves which could capsize or damage vessels and reduce visibility. P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S... Mariners should prepare for dangerous accumulation of ice on their vessel. If possible, remain in port, avoid the warning area or conduct mitigation. Mariners should alter plans to avoid these hazardous conditions.
